Seamless in-roof solar for an historic farmhouse

Integrating modern solar technology into an old farmhouse while preserving its historic character posed a unique challenge. The homeowner sought to enhance energy efficiency and reduce carbon emissions without compromising the aesthetics of the traditional slate roof.

To ensure a seamless and visually appealing integration, we embedded 20 high-performance solar panels directly into the slate roof. This approach maintained the farmhouse’s classic appearance while maximizing solar efficiency.

The 12kWp system now generates approximately 12,000kWh per year, significantly reducing the property’s reliance on grid electricity. With annual CO2 emissions reduced by 6,253kg, this installation represents a major step toward a more sustainable and eco-friendly future.
